Prepare Your Battery for the Season

Battery issues always show up during winter and summer. Although you may not do much about the high or low temperatures, you can protect your battery and prevent some problems. Ensure your battery terminals are free from acidic buildup that could affect its performance.

You should also have it inspected by the auto mechanic to ensure it doesn’t fail when you are in the middle of nowhere. If it is faulty, consider replacing it to avoid disappointments.

Inspect the Brakes

Brakes are crucial parts of any automobile. As you usher in the travel-filled seasons, ensure that your brakes are in perfect shape. If you notice any slight change in the brakes’ functioning or hear squealing sounds when braking, you should seek help at your favorite auto repair shop.

Faulty brakes could result from inappropriate brake fluid levels, brake pads, or leakage in the brake liquid. Fortunately, a visit to a local auto repair shop will have all these problems fixed.

Take Care of the Engine

You should inspect your cooling systems often and take measures to protect the engine from overheating. Whenever you notice the coolant lights, it means your engine is at risk of overheating. But how do you prevent your engine from overheating?

You should check your coolant level frequently and take your car for service. Most car engine failures are a result of overheating. Therefore, you should take precautions not to become a victim.
